Cr12MoV Tool Steel / GOST X12MФ Steel

Cr12MoV represents the pinnacle of high-performance cold-work tool steels, meticulously engineered and refined through advanced metallurgical processes. Its foundation lies in high carbon (C) and high chromium (Cr) content, enhanced by the strategic addition of molybdenum (Mo) and vanadium (V). This unique composition establishes its preeminent status within the tool steel spectrum. Molybdenum markedly enhances the steel’s high-temperature strength and resistance to tempering softening, while vanadium further refines the grain structure, boosting toughness and secondary hardening effects. The synergistic action of these four key elements collectively endows Cr12MoV with exceptional hardness, wear resistance, and impact toughness, making it the ideal choice for demanding cold work applications.

Cr12MoV is a type of cold-worked tool steel with high carbon and high chromium content. It possesses extremely high wear resistance and excellent hardenability, and is widely used in the manufacturing of cold stamping and forming molds that are subjected to heavy loads and require high wear resistance.

Chemical Composition of Cr12MoV / GOST X12MФ tool steel

C Si Mn Cr P S Mo V
1.45-1.70 0.40 0.40 11.00-12.50 max 0.030 max 0.030 0.40-0.60 0.15-0.30

Core Performance Advantages of Cr12MoV X12MФ tool steel

Exceptional Wear Resistance, Long-Lasting Stability: Benefiting from its high-carbon, high-chromium composition, Cr12MoV exhibits extraordinary hardness and wear resistance. It effectively withstands continuous punching, shearing, and stretching of high-strength materials like silicon steel sheets and low-carbon steel plates, significantly extending mould service life and reducing downtime for replacements.

Exceptional Compressive Strength, Heavy-Duty Performance: Superior hardenability and the effects of strengthening elements endow Cr12MoV with outstanding compressive strength. During demanding processes like blanking, cold forging, and precision forming, it withstands immense impact forces without deformation or fracture, ensuring safe and reliable operation under heavy loads.

Excellent Heat Treatment Stability and Dimensional Accuracy: Cr12MoV exhibits good hardenability and dimensional stability. Following meticulous heat treatment, it exhibits minimal deformation, maintaining precise dimensions and superior performance over extended periods, providing reliable assurance for high-precision blanking dies.

A Delicate Balance of Toughness and Hardness: The optimised alloy composition (particularly the addition of vanadium) ensures high hardness while imparting good toughness to the material. This effectively reduces the risk of brittle fracture under complex operating conditions, enhancing overall reliability.

Cr12MoV Cold Work Tool Steel Applications

It is precisely through this outstanding combination of properties that Cr12MoV tool steel demonstrates formidable applicability across numerous demanding cold-working tooling fields:

Precision Stamping/Cutting Dies: High-precision, high-volume stamping and blanking of thin metal sheets for automotive components, electronic connectors, lead frames, and similar applications.

High-Strength Shearing/Cutting Tools: Sharp cutting edges for shearing silicon steel sheets, stainless steel plates, aluminium sheets, etc., such as shear blades and trimming dies.

Cold Extrusion/Forging Dies: Used for cold extrusion forming and forging of standard components, bearing rings, and complex-shaped parts.

Drawing/Bending Dies: Die components for deep-drawn products like stainless steel vessels and beverage can bodies.

Gauges, measuring tools and industrial wear parts: Precision instruments, fixture bushings and other industrial components demanding exceptional wear resistance.

Outstanding material properties hinge on rigorous production control and quality assurance systems. Recognising that tool steel quality is vital to your production, we implement comprehensive quality control from raw materials to finished products:

Source Control: Premier Melting Processes Employing advanced Electric Arc Furnace (EAF) or Ultra-High Power Electric Arc Furnace (UHP) melting technologies, combined with ladle refining (e.g., LF furnace) and vacuum degassing (VD/VOD) processes. This rigorously removes harmful gases (hydrogen, oxygen, nitrogen) and inclusions from molten steel, ensuring high material purity alongside uniform and precise chemical composition.

Dense Structure: Precision forged billets undergo multi-directional repeated forging at elevated temperatures. This process thoroughly disrupts porosity and dendrites within the cast structure, eliminating internal defects. This significantly enhances material density, uniformity, and isotropy (consistent properties in all directions).

Core Essence: Advanced Heat Treatment Technology Precise control of quenching and multiple tempering parameters (temperature, duration, cooling rate) yields ideal matrix structures (e.g., high-carbon martensite) and uniformly dispersed high-hardness carbides. Dual vacuum heat treatment (vacuum quenching + vacuum tempering) marks the hallmark of premium quality, effectively preventing oxidation and decarburisation while safeguarding surface finish and dimensional accuracy.

Rigorous Validation: Multi-dimensional Quality Inspection

Each batch undergoes:

Chemical Composition Analysis: Ensures elemental content meets stringent standards.

Hardness/Mechanical Properties Testing: Precisely evaluates critical post-quenching/tempering metrics including hardness, flexural strength, and impact toughness.

Metallographic examination: High-magnification microscopy assesses carbide morphology, size, distribution, and matrix structure—crucial indicators of heat treatment quality and intrinsic material performance.

Ultrasonic flaw detection: Thoroughly scans for internal cracks, inclusions, and other macro defects, guaranteeing reliable core integrity.
